Upgrade Introduces Secured OneCard: A Secure and Rewarding Credit Solution

FinTech innovator Upgrade has unveiled a new addition to its financial product lineup — the Secured OneCard, as stated in PYMNTS News. This card has been meticulously crafted to cater to individuals who possess limited or no credit history, according to a press release dated December 13, 2023.

Upgrade’s CEO, Renaud Laplanche, expressed the rationale behind this launch, stating, «We believe Secured OneCard is an ideal product for tens of millions of people who haven’t yet had a chance to build a credit history. While building credit for the long term, Secured OneCard also provides high cash back rewards and APY, giving users immediate and tangible benefits, putting more money into their pocket today.»

Similar to its predecessor, the Upgrade OneCard, the Secured OneCard empowers users with options like Pay Now and Pay Later, enticing cashback offers, and robust fraud protection.

The key differentiator lies in the Secured OneCard’s suitability for individuals who may not qualify for an unsecured credit card. It extends smaller credit lines, backed by funds deposited in a savings account that accrues interest.

Getting started with the Secured OneCard is straightforward, with a minimal initial deposit requirement of $200 and zero annual fees. There are no ongoing minimum balance obligations, and users can withdraw funds exceeding their credit balance at their convenience.

One of the most compelling aspects of the Secured OneCard is its potential to help users build their credit history. With responsible usage, cardholders can unlock access to unsecured credit and transition seamlessly to an unsecured OneCard without the hassle of reapplying or changing card numbers.

This addition to Upgrade’s product portfolio underscores the company’s commitment to offering affordable and responsible credit, mobile banking, and payment solutions.

Upgrade initially introduced the OneCard in July 2022, aimed at simplifying daily expenses and payments for consumers. Renaud Laplanche, commenting on the launch at that time, remarked, «With Upgrade OneCard, consumers don’t have to make that choice anymore; they can use Pay Now for everyday expenses to avoid interest and fee charges while earning credit card rewards without running the risk of falling into credit card debt.»
